Cancellation. If client fails to appear for session without 24 hours notice, there will be no session rescheduled. Rescheduling * If an illness or situation prevents a photo session from taking place, client may reschedule their session at least 24 hours prior to their shoot without penalty. Should client fail to give 24 hours notice, or decide to completely cancel the shoot, this session fee is forfeited and will not be refunded. Photographer reserves the right to reschedule due to illness, weather, equipment malfunction, or other circumstances beyond their control. 3. Photographic Materials. All photographic materials, including but not limited to negatives or digital files, transparencies, proofs, and previews, shall be the exclusive property of the Photographer. Photographer shall make previews available to the Client for the purpose of selecting photographs should they decide to purchase. 4. Copyright and Release. The Photographer shall own the copyright in all images created and shall have the exclusive right to make reproductions. The Photographer shall only make reproductions for the Client or for the Photographer’s portfolio, samples, self-promotions, entry in photographic contests or art exhibitions, editorial use, for display, or any other business use. 5. All disputes arising under Agreement shall be submitted to binding arbitration before a judge in West Virginia courts and the arbitration award may be entered for judgment in any court having jurisdiction thereof. Notwithstanding the foregoing, either party may refuse to arbitrate when the dispute is for a sum less than $1000. 7. Miscellaneous. This Agreement incorporates the entire understanding of the parties. Any modifications of this Agreement must be in writing and signed by both parties. Any waiver of a breach or default hereunder shall not be deemed a waiver of a subsequent breach or default of either the same provision or any other provision of this Agreement. 8. Model Release. The PHOTOGRAPHER reserves the right to use images created under this contract for advertising, display, publication or other purposes. The Client signing this contract warrants that he or shee has actual authority to agree to the use of the likeness of all persons included in the portrait in this manner and shall indemnify and defend the PHOTOGRAPHER in the event of litigation arising out of such use. Negatives, digital files and previews remain the exclusive property of the PHOTOGRAPHER. 9. Archive of Session Images . After 2 years, all images will be purged from photographer’s hard-drive, except as needed for promotional purposes, to be determined by photographer at photographer’s sole discretion. Photographer is not responsible for loss or damage to the digital files due to circumstances beyond photographer’s control. 10. Damage . Photographer is not responsible for the damage of portraits after delivery to client, including damage caused during transit by US mail. Client assumes all responsibility for the safety of all portraits upon receipt. 11. Liability . Photographer is not responsible for any injuries inflicted upon any participating parties. Client(s) will be responsible for their children and for themselves and release photographer from any claims against their person or their business.
